Transaction 40885a5de5bf53ac764049f8101ddec1fba39b9311d0fd5e4ec422e1037e398a
1 Input
1 Output
-
40885a5de5bf53ac764049f8101ddec1fba39b9311d0fd5e4ec422e1037e398a:0
- value
- 6437081
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5820b6c51d62cae35c1ba5e70ccb3770e0688b06 OP_EQUAL
- address
- 39izaRsQbbWR22zvn8R8MMbzMgRBxAZcwW